Think Dirty
The Think Dirty app is a helpful tool for anyone interested in learning more about the ingredients in their beauty products. Simply scan the barcode of a product and the app will provide detailed information on its ingredients. Users can then rate the product based on its safety, and the app provides tips on how to find cleaner alternatives.
The app also includes a blog with articles on topics such as green living and ingredient safety. The Think Dirty app is a great resource, whether you’re looking to switch to a more natural beauty routine or just want to be more informed about the products you’re using.
Shop Ethical!
Shop Ethical! is an Australian app that allows you to scan barcodes to see how ethical a product is. The app rates products on a range of criteria, including animal welfare, human rights, and environmental impact. It provides users with information on the environmental and social impact of various products, as well as ratings from multiple ethical rating organizations.
This makes it easy for shoppers to compare products and make informed choices about what they buy. In addition, the app also offers exclusive discounts and deals on ethical products, making it even easier to shop ethically.
Seafood Watch
Seafood Watch is an iOS and Android app that helps you make sustainable seafood choices. The app provides information on which seafood species are most at risk of being overfished and which are farmed responsibly. Simply enter the name of the fish or shellfish you’re considering, and the app will provide you with a color-coded rating.
Green indicates that the seafood is a “best choice,” yellow means it’s a “good alternative,” and red means it should be avoided. The app also contains useful information on each seafood species, including its habitat, life cycle, and how it’s caught or farmed.
